### Watchdog restart loop (Lanternbox kiosks)

If a Lanternbox kiosk reboots every few minutes, the Pinefold watchdog is likely failing its heartbeat check. First confirm the display process is alive; if so, the watchdog's health endpoint is probably rejecting calls due to an expired credential. Clock drift over 90 seconds also causes this. Re-sync NTP, then re-register the unit. To query the watchdog API directly during triage, authenticate with the token below.

portal login ticket: eyJhbGciOiJIUzI1NiIsInR5cCI6IkpXVCJ9.eyJzdWIiOiI0Z4ywpUMsBIn0.ca5FVhkdBXa3

## Runbook: Currency rounding drift (Tollgate FX)

If the ledger reconciliation alert fires with sub-cent deltas, it's almost always the rounding mode in Tollgate FX, not a data problem. Conversions are supposed to round half-even at four decimals before aggregation; if someone flipped it to half-up, totals drift by a few cents per thousand transactions. Check recent config pushes first and compare against the baseline. The expected production configuration values are shown below.

deployment values, tafof-taduf:
pelius:
  pin: 6508
  tenant: praiel
  seal: seal_4e33a2f4
  metrics_host: metrics.pelius.plorvagrid.corp
  standby_team: druix
  escalation: juldor-norius
  nonce: 5db598

Ticket: Drift causing websocket reconnect storm — RelayHatch

Prod and staging have diverged on RelayHatch reconnect settings. Staging got the fixed backoff curve in the Tarnwell patch; prod still runs the old aggressive retry, which is why clients hammer the gateway after every deploy and we see the reconnect storm logged as a bug. It isn't a code defect — it's drift. Recommend freezing the next release until prod is realigned. The intended production configuration values follow.

service settings:
[casax]
port = 6379
team = rusir
host = casax.zemvarhq.corp
region = outer-4
access_code = ac_9808ce
timeout_ms = 1500